The HPD (Hot Plug Detect) signal is present in many (probably even
"most") eDP panels. For eDP, this signal isn't actually used for
detecting hot-plugs of the panel but is more akin to a "panel ready"
signal. After you provide power to the panel, panel timing diagrams
typically say that you should wait for HPD to be asserted (or wait a
fixed amount of time) before talking to the panel.

The panel-simple bindings describes many eDP panels and many of these
panels provide the HPD signal. We should add the HPD-related
properties to the panel-simple bindings. The HPD properties are
actually defined in panel-common.yaml, so adding them here just
documents that they are OK for panels handled by the panel-simple
bindings.

NOTE: whether or not we'd include HPD properties in the panel node is
more a property of the board design than the panel itself. For most
boards using these eDP panels everything "magically" works without
specifying any HPD properties and that's been why we haven't needed to
allow the HPD properties earlier. On these boards the HPD signal goes
directly to a dedicated "HPD" input to the eDP controller and this
connection doesn't need to be described in the device tree. The only
time the HPD properties are needed in the device tree are if HPD is
hooked up to a GPIO or if HPD is normally on the panel but isn't used
on a given board. That means that if we don't allow the HPD properties
in panel-simple then one could argue that we've got to boot all eDP
panels (or at least all those that someone could conceivably put on a
system where HPD goes to a GPIO or isn't hooked up) from panel-simple.
